Information literacy in the digital age [electronic resource] / by Laura Perdew ; content consultant, Leslie F. Stebbins.
The flow of information through our modern digital world has led to many new issues and controversies. Information Literacy in the Digital Age examines the challenges involved in seeking and evaluating information from the vast array of sources available through digital technology.
